同一个云服务器如何创建多个网站链接,多网站布局攻略同一个云服务器轻松实现网站集群,全方位解析!
- 综合资讯
- 2024-12-18 06:28:52
- 1

轻松在单个云服务器上构建多个网站链接,实现多网站布局!本文全面解析网站集群搭建攻略,助你高效管理多个网站。...
轻松在单个云服务器上构建多个网站链接,实现多网站布局!本文全面解析网站集群搭建攻略,助你高效管理多个网站。
https://www.example.com/multiple-sites-on-same-server-guide
在当今互联网时代,一个企业或个人可能需要同时运营多个网站以满足不同业务需求,购买多个云服务器无疑会增加成本,如何才能在同一个云服务器上创建多个网站呢?本文将为您详细解析如何在同一个云服务器上创建多个网站,让您轻松实现网站集群。
选择合适的云服务器
要实现同一个云服务器上创建多个网站,您需要选择一台具备足够资源的云服务器,以下是一些选择云服务器的建议:
1、内存:至少4GB内存,以保证多个网站同时运行时的稳定性。
2、CPU:至少2核CPU,以满足多任务处理的需求。
3、硬盘:建议使用SSD硬盘,以提高网站访问速度。
4、网络带宽:至少1Mbps,以满足高并发访问的需求。
搭建虚拟主机环境
在同一个云服务器上创建多个网站,可以通过搭建虚拟主机环境来实现,以下是一些常见的虚拟主机环境搭建方法:
1、使用Apache模块:Apache是一款开源的Web服务器软件,支持虚拟主机功能,您可以通过以下步骤搭建Apache虚拟主机环境:
a. 安装Apache服务器:使用您的云服务器操作系统自带的包管理工具安装Apache服务器。
b. 创建虚拟主机配置文件:在Apache的配置目录下创建一个新的配置文件,如/etc/apache2/sites-available/vhost1.conf
。
c. 配置虚拟主机:在配置文件中设置虚拟主机的域名、文档根目录、错误日志等参数。
d. 启用虚拟主机:将配置文件链接到/etc/apache2/sites-enabled/
目录下,并重启Apache服务器。
2、使用Nginx模块:Nginx是一款高性能的Web服务器软件,同样支持虚拟主机功能,以下是一些搭建Nginx虚拟主机环境的步骤:
a. 安装Nginx服务器:使用您的云服务器操作系统自带的包管理工具安装Nginx服务器。
b. 创建虚拟主机配置文件:在Nginx的配置目录下创建一个新的配置文件,如/etc/nginx/sites-available/vhost1.conf
。
c. 配置虚拟主机:在配置文件中设置虚拟主机的域名、文档根目录、错误日志等参数。
d. 启用虚拟主机:将配置文件链接到/etc/nginx/sites-enabled/
目录下,并重启Nginx服务器。
配置DNS解析
完成虚拟主机环境搭建后,您需要在DNS解析服务商处为每个网站配置相应的域名解析,以下是一些常见的DNS解析服务商:
1、云端解析:阿里云、腾讯云、华为云等。
2、国外解析服务商:Cloudflare、DNSPod等。
在DNS解析服务商处为每个网站配置以下参数:
1、主机记录:与虚拟主机配置文件中的ServerName
参数一致。
2、记录类型:A记录或CNAME记录,取决于您的域名是否指向云服务器ip地址。
3、记录值:云服务器IP地址。
在同一个云服务器上创建多个网站后,您需要将每个网站的内容分别上传到对应的文档根目录,以下是一些网站内容配置方法:
1、使用FTP客户端:使用FTP客户端将网站内容上传到云服务器上对应的文档根目录。
2、使用SSH终端:通过SSH终端,使用scp
命令将网站内容上传到云服务器上对应的文档根目录。
3、使用网站管理工具:使用WordPress、Drupal等网站管理工具,通过其内置的网站迁移功能将网站内容迁移到云服务器上。
优化网站性能
在同一个云服务器上创建多个网站后,您需要关注网站性能,以确保所有网站都能正常运行,以下是一些优化网站性能的方法:
1、使用CDN加速:通过CDN(内容分发网络)加速网站内容,提高网站访问速度。
2、优化网站代码:精简网站代码,提高网站加载速度。
3、使用缓存:使用缓存技术,如Varnish、Memcached等,提高网站访问速度。
4、定期更新网站:定期更新网站内容,提高网站收录和排名。
在同一个云服务器上创建多个网站,可以降低企业或个人的运营成本,通过以上方法,您可以在同一个云服务器上轻松实现网站集群,满足不同业务需求,希望本文对您有所帮助!
本文链接:https://zhitaoyun.cn/1636737.html
发表评论